CHARLES SCRIBNER'S SONS 1931, 1931. First Edition. hardcover. Very Good. 0x0x0. Charles Scribners Sons; New York, 1931. Hardcover. First Edition. A Very Good, yellow cloth binding with black lettering on front board and spine and illustration on bottom front board, binding intact, spine fade with some foxing to spine buckram, deckle fore-edge, rub mark bottom text block edge, some age toning to pages, blank bookplate affirmed to front free endpaper, top text block edge dusty, some discoloration to pastedowns and endpapers, bit of discoloration to pastedowns/endpapers, spine buckram starting to separate from backing material, rubbing to board and spine edges, in a Very Good, moderate handling/scuff marks to panels, bit of edge/corner wear, sunned spine and verso, few tears and chips along edges, moisture stain bottom spine and verso, Mylar protected, Dust wrapper. A nice and overall clean copy. 8vo[octavo or approx. 6 x 9 inches]. 314pp., b&w illustrations. We pack securely and ship daily with delivery confirmation on every book.
